Subject: Re: [PATCH V4 XRT Alveo 12/20] fpga: xrt: VSEC platform driver
Date: Fri, 2 Apr 2021 07:12:14 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<d26476fc-e559-72eb-0e6f-decb06ca7227@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210324052947.27889-13-lizhi.hou@xilinx.com>

local use of 'regmap' conflicts with global meaning.

reword local regmap to something else.

On 3/23/21 10:29 PM, Lizhi Hou wrote:
> Add VSEC driver. VSEC is a hardware function discovered by walking
> PCI Express configure space. A platform device node will be created
> for it. VSEC provides board logic UUID and few offset of other hardware
> functions.
